如何知道网站的服务器类型

不及物动词 其他 30

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要知道一个网站的服务器类型,可以采用以下几种方法:

    1. 使用在线工具:有一些在线工具可以检测一个网站的服务器类型。例如,"What's My DNS"可以提供网站的DNS记录,包括服务器类型和IP地址。只需在工具的搜索框中输入网站的域名,然后点击搜索即可获取相关信息。

    2. 使用Web开发者工具:现代浏览器通常都有内置的开发者工具,可以检查网站的元素和网络请求。通过打开开发者工具的网络选项卡,可以查看网站发送的所有请求。在请求的头部信息中,通常可以找到服务器类型。例如,Apache服务器通常会在头部信息中包含"Server: Apache"。

    3. 使用命令行工具:如果你有访问命令行界面的权限,可以使用一些命令行工具来探测网站的服务器类型。例如,在Windows上,可以使用"nslookup"命令来查找网站的DNS记录,其中包含服务器类型和IP地址。在Linux和Mac上,可以使用"dig"命令来执行相同的操作。

    4. 使用Whois查询:使用Whois查询可以查找一个网站的注册信息。尽管它不能直接告诉你服务器的类型,但可以提供网站使用的DNS服务提供商的信息,从而得知一些关于服务器的线索。例如,某些DNS服务提供商通常使用特定类型的服务器。

    5. 分析HTTP响应头部:通过发送一个HTTP请求并分析返回的响应头部信息,可以获取网站服务器的类型。你可以使用诸如cURL或Python中的requests库来发送HTTP请求,并从服务器返回的响应中提取"Server"字段的值。这个字段通常会包含服务器的类型和版本信息。

    虽然这些方法可以帮助你获取一个网站的服务器类型,但也需要注意到这些信息可能会被网站管理员隐藏或修改。因此,这些方法只能提供一些有限的线索,不能保证100%准确。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要了解一个网站的服务器类型,可以通过以下几种方法进行:

    1. 使用在线工具或扩展程序:有许多在线工具和浏览器扩展程序可以帮助你获取网站的服务器类型。例如,"Wappalyzer"、"BuiltWith"、"WhatRuns"等。这些工具可以通过检测网站的HTTP响应头或分析网站的源代码来确定所使用的服务器类型。

    2. 使用命令行工具:如果你是一个开发人员或对命令行感兴趣,你可以使用一些命令行工具来获取网站的服务器类型。在Windows系统上,你可以使用“NSLookup”和“Tracert”命令,而在Linux系统上,你可以使用“ping”和“traceroute”命令。这些命令将向网站的域名发送请求并返回一些有关服务器的信息,包括服务器类型。

    3. 分析HTTP响应头:HTTP响应头是一个服务器在响应客户端请求时发送给客户端的一系列信息。通过查看网站的HTTP响应头,你可以找到一些有关网站所使用服务器的信息。例如,使用浏览器的"开发者工具"或类似的网络监视工具,可以检查HTTP响应头中的"Server"字段。该字段通常会显示服务器的类型和版本。

    4. 分析网站源代码:通过查看网站的源代码,你可以找到一些关于服务器类型的线索。例如,如果网站使用Apache服务器,你可能会在源代码中找到包含"Apache"关键字的注释或指示。类似地,如果网站使用Nginx服务器,你可能会在源代码中找到包含"Nginx"关键字的指示。

    需要注意的是,以上方法只能提供一些关于网站服务器类型的线索,无法100%确定服务器类型。这是因为有些网站可能会隐藏或修改其服务器类型信息。重要的是要使用多种方法进行验证和确认,以获得尽可能准确的结果。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要知道一个网站的服务器类型,可以通过以下几种方法:

    一、使用在线工具:
    1、通过域名搜索工具:在网上可以找到许多在线域名搜索工具,例如"Whois"和"Dig Web Interface"等。在这些工具中,输入目标网站的域名并搜索,你将能够获得关于该网站的许多信息,包括服务器类型。
    2、使用网站服务器检测工具:有一些专门用于检测网站服务器类型的在线工具,例如"whatruns"和"Wappalyzer"等。输入目标网站的URL,并运行检测工具,它将为您提供有关该网站所使用的服务器类型的信息。

    二、使用浏览器开发者工具:
    1、在浏览器中打开目标网站,并右键单击页面上的任何位置。
    2、选择"检查"或"检查元素"等选项,打开浏览器的开发者工具。
    3、在开发者工具中,选择"网络"或"网络"选项卡,并刷新页面。
    4、在网络请求列表中,查找"服务器"或"Server"这一列。该列中将显示服务器的类型,例如"Apache"、"Nginx"或"Microsoft-IIS"等。

    三、使用命令行工具:
    1、打开命令提示符或终端窗口。
    2、使用"ping"命令来查找网站的IP地址。例如,输入"ping http://www.example.com",然后按下回车键。
    3、得到网站的IP地址后,使用"nslookup"命令来查找该IP地址所对应的服务器。例如,输入"nslookup <IP地址>",然后按下回车键。
    4、命令行将显示服务器的名称,你可以通过该名称判断出服务器的类型。

    需要注意的是,这些方法并不是百分之百准确,因为网站的服务器类型可以通过一些技术手段进行隐藏或伪装。使用这些方法只能提供推测或预测的结果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部